Why Granite Countertops Are Ideal for Suburban Homes

Black & White Granite Kitchen

Granite countertops have long been a staple in high-end homes, and their popularity continues to rise in suburban kitchens and bathrooms. Offering a perfect balance of beauty, durability, and functionality, granite is an excellent choice for homeowners seeking long-lasting quality and timeless appeal. 

Whether you’re remodeling a suburban kitchen or building a new home, granite countertops can enhance the aesthetic and value of your living space. Let’s explore why granite is the ideal material for suburban homes.

Timeless Beauty and Elegance

One of the most significant advantages of granite countertops is their natural beauty. Each granite slab is unique, with its own set of patterns, veining, and color variations. From deep earth tones to light, airy hues, granite offers a wide range of options to match any interior design style. Whether your suburban home has a traditional, transitional, or modern aesthetic, granite countertops can elevate the overall design.

Granite’s luxurious appearance creates a sophisticated and timeless look that is always in demand. Unlike trends that come and go, granite countertops maintain their appeal year after year, ensuring that your home remains stylish for the long haul. As a result, granite is an investment that will not only enhance the beauty of your home but also help retain its value.

Exceptional Durability and Longevity

Granite Countertops Pros and Cons

Granite is one of the most durable materials available for countertops. Known for its strength and resilience, granite is highly resistant to scratches, chips, and cracks. This makes it perfect for busy households, especially in suburban homes where cooking, entertaining, and family activities often take place.

The hardness of granite also makes it less likely to be damaged by everyday use, such as cutting, prepping, or handling hot pots and pans. 

In fact, granite can withstand high temperatures, meaning you don’t need to worry about accidentally placing a hot pan directly on the surface. (That said, you should be careful and use trivets or hot pads– while granite won’t be damaged by heat, the sealant that protects it can be!) For a material that can handle the rigors of daily life while still looking pristine, granite is unmatched.

Low Maintenance and Easy to Care For

Suburban homeowners often seek materials that require minimal upkeep, and granite countertops are known for being low-maintenance. 

While granite does need to be sealed periodically to maintain its resistance to stains and moisture, this process is simple and infrequent. Unlike other natural stones like marble, which can be highly porous and prone to staining, granite is relatively stain-resistant, making it ideal for kitchens and bathrooms.

Daily cleaning of granite countertops is as easy as wiping them down with a mild dish soap and a soft cloth. With proper care, granite can maintain its shine and appearance for decades. This ease of maintenance is a key reason why granite is so popular in suburban homes where homeowners want beauty without the hassle of constant upkeep.

Adds Value to Your Home

One of the most significant benefits of installing granite countertops in a suburban home is the value they can add. Granite is highly regarded for its quality, and many homebuyers view granite countertops as a desirable feature. It’s considered a premium material that is associated with upscale living. If you plan to sell your home in the future, investing in granite countertops can increase its market appeal and potentially lead to a higher resale price.
